作为微软Windows Server的重要组成部分,Hyper-V自诞生以来,凭借其强大的功能和便捷的管理工具,赢得了众多企业和开发者的青睐
然而,正如任何技术都有其局限性和不足,Hyper-V也不例外
本文将深入探讨Hyper-V的缺点,旨在为读者提供一个全面、客观的认识
一、高昂的成本 首先,不得不提的是Hyper-V的成本问题
尽管Hyper-V是Windows Server操作系统的一部分,但它需要额外的许可证和硬件资源来支持虚拟化
这意味着,企业在部署Hyper-V时,不仅需要购买Windows Server的许可证,还需要为Hyper-V的虚拟化功能支付额外的费用
与其他虚拟化平台相比,Hyper-V的成本显然更高
这对于预算有限的企业来说,无疑是一个沉重的负担
此外,Hyper-V的硬件要求也相对较高
由于它需要使用CPU虚拟化扩展,因此只能在支持该功能的硬件上运行
这意味着,企业在选择服务器时,必须优先考虑支持CPU虚拟化扩展的型号,这无疑增加了硬件采购的成本
二、安全性方面的挑战 尽管Hyper-V提供了一些内置的安全功能,如安全启动和保护措施,以保护虚拟机和主机免受恶意软件和攻击,但它仍然容易受到攻击
这是因为Hyper-V在操作系统的内核层次上运行,因此安全漏洞可能会对整个系统产生影响
一旦控制层操作系统崩溃,所有虚拟机都将受到影响,这种风险是企业在选择虚拟化平台时必须认真考虑的
此外,尽管Hyper-V支持网络虚拟化,以保护虚拟机免受网络攻击,但这种保护并非万无一失
随着网络攻击手段的不断升级和复杂化,Hyper-V在网络安全性方面仍需不断加强和完善
三、功能上的局限性 与其他虚拟化平台相比,Hyper-V在功能上存在一些局限性
例如,它不支持远程连接,这意味着用户无法直接从远程位置访问和管理虚拟机
这对于需要跨地域管理的企业来说,无疑是一个不小的挑战
此外,Hyper-V在USB设备支持方面也存在不足
它无法直接使用USB设备,这对于需要频繁使用USB设备进行数据传输和调试的用户来说,无疑是一个不便之处
四、兼容性问题 虽然Hyper-V支持多种操作系统,包括Windows、Linux、FreeBSD等,但它在兼容性方面仍存在问题
某些应用程序可能无法在Hyper-V上运行,或者在运行过程中会出现不稳定的情况
这对于需要运行特定应用程序的企业来说,无疑是一个潜在的风险
此外,虚拟机之间的兼容性也可能存在问题
在某些情况下,虚拟机可能无法在不同的Hyper-V环境中迁移和运行,这限制了虚拟机的灵活性和可扩展性
五、性能上的瓶颈 尽管Hyper-V在性能上表现出色,支持多个处理器、多个内存通道、网络虚拟化和存储虚拟化等高级功能,但在某些特定场景下,它仍可能面临性能瓶颈
例如,在处理大量I/O操作时,Hyper-V的性能可能会受到影响
这可能导致虚拟机运行缓慢或不稳定,影响业务的连续性和效率
此外,Hyper-V在实时迁移和动态优化方面也存在一定的局限性
虽然它支持这些功能,但在实际操作中,可能会遇到一些技术难题和性能瓶颈
这限制了Hyper-V在高可用性和故障转移方面的表现
六、管理和维护的复杂性 尽管Hyper-V提供了可视化的管理工具,使得创建、配置和管理虚拟机变得更加容易和直观,但在实际操作中,管理和维护Hyper-V环境仍然具有一定的复杂性
这主要源于以下几个方面: 首先,Hyper-V的配置和管理需要一定的专业知识和经验
对于不熟悉该技术的用户来说,可能会遇到一些技术难题和操作障碍
其次,Hyper-V环境的监控和故障排除也需要一定的时间和精力
由于虚拟化环境的复杂性和动态性,及时发现和解决潜在问题对于确
Xshell技巧:如何实现SSH自动登录,提升工作效率
Hyper-V的短板:不可忽视的几大缺点
Hyper Scan:极速扫描技术揭秘
Xshell轻松链接,玩转树莓派新体验
Xshell链接:高效远程连接工具详解
Xshell操作小技巧:如何快速实现强制退出教程
Win2016 Hyper:虚拟化技术新探索
Linux系统不可忽视的几大缺点
Hyper-V虚拟机:安全拔出设备指南
Hyper-V监控工具:性能优化必备利器
Hyper平台加载硬盘全攻略
Hyper-V虚拟机如何设置外网访问?实用教程助你轻松搞定!
“电脑设置缺失:远程桌面不见了?”
Hyper-V拨号:虚拟环境下的网络连接技巧
Hyper-V本地搭建:轻松构建虚拟环境
批量创建Hyper-V虚拟机的高效技巧
VMware迁移至Hyper-V导出指南
Hyper-V启动失败:排查与解决方案
Hyper-V ISO镜像下载指南